So you are saying that you want to run your filled bottles through a dishwasher in order to sterilize the wine??
If so, that level of excessive heat can not be good for wine. You would be far better off using sorbate and/or k-meta.
If you are going for organic wine, and do not want to use chemicals, then I suggest that you simply bulk age for a year or two before you bottle.
